There are a variety of double glazed frames, including uPVC and aluminium. Each has its own advantages and drawbacks. For example, uPVC is the most sought-after choice because it's light and easy to install. It is also recyclable and has a high energy rating. The drawback to uPVC is that it can be difficult to clean and could fade over time.
Triple glazing is an alternative that is energy efficient and could save you money on your heating bill. This kind of window is composed of three glass panes and incorporates a thermal insert which creates smaller rooms to reduce the loss of heat. The window is sealed and contains Argon gas, which helps insulate and keep your home warmer.

Condensation
If your double-glazed windows mist up during cold and damp days, this could be an indication that the seals are beginning to fail. This is usually a result of the accumulation of condensation, which has damaged the desiccant, which sits between the glass units and helps to keep the gas argon inside and stops water from entering the gap.
